Fantastic tradicional Spanish villa situated at walking distance Javea Old Town.Tradicional Spanish villa for sale near the town of Javea. Completly renovate in 2004, it is distributed in two levels and the entrance is made by an open Naya. Comprising a large living room with fireplace, fully fitted kitchen and utility room that connects to the back of the house and to the garage with its own fire place, 5 double size bedrooms and 3 bathrooms, (one en suite).The property is equipped with gas heating, underfloor heating in the living room, air conditioning (hot-cold), large garage, utility room, storage room, cellar, barbecue, 10x5 m pool. large parking and garden with orange trees.IBI: 800€

In Spain, two primary taxes are associated with property purchases: IVA (Value Added Tax) and ITP (Property Transfer Tax). IVA, typically applicable to new constructions, stands at 10% of the property's value. On the other hand, ITP, levied on resale properties, varies between regions but generally ranges from 6% to 10%.
